Below, the sales manager of the company will explain the properties of various materials of stainless steel mesh for everyone to facilitate everyone's choice.
302 stainless steel mesh has high hardness and low nickel content, and the market is relatively chaotic.
The commonality of 304, 304HC, and 304L stainless steel mesh is that the nickel content is not less than 8%; 304HC contains copper and has good ductility.H is a shorthand for High, and C is a shorthand for Cu (copper).
304L stainless steel mesh has a carbon content of ≤0.03%, also known as low carbon 304, L is a shorthand for low or less
The commonality of 316 and 316L stainless steel mesh is that it has a higher nickel content, and the carbon content of 316L is less than 0.03%, which is softer and is called low-carbon and high-nickel.
321 stainless steel mesh contains titanium, titanium will improve the alkali resistance of the wire, alkali resistance and high temperature resistance
430 stainless steel mesh, also known as stainless iron, is commonly used in the production of cleaning ball wire
201, 202 stainless steel mesh contains manganese and has good wear resistance. It is often made of high manganese stainless steel. 202 is also known as non-magnetic and nickel-free.
310S stainless steel mesh has good high temperature resistance, 310S stainless steel mesh can withstand high temperatures of 1100 degrees, and 314 stainless steel mesh can withstand high temperatures of 1400 degrees.
